Sr. Software Engineer responsible for designing software capabilities for clients at Enlighten, a leading tech firm. Collaborating with engineers to deliver high-quality solutions within hybrid work environment.
Responsibilities
Responsible for designing, developing, and implementing complex software capabilities for computer-based systems.
Work closely with other talented engineers to create software solutions that meet the needs of our clients.
Opportunity to work with modern tools and technologies.
Encouraged to stay up-to-date with the latest developments in the field.
Part of a dynamic and collaborative team committed to delivering high-quality software solutions to our clients.
Requirements
A current TS/SCI level U.S. Government security clearance is required; U.S. citizenship required.
At least 9 years of experience in Software Engineering, Modern Java Frameworks and Libraries (e.g. Spring, Guava) and a Bachelors in related field; 7 years relevant experience with Masters in related field; or High School Diploma or equivalent and 13 years relevant experience.
Proven experience engineering, deploying, and maintaining high-performance, large-scale distributed platform solutions to handle high transaction volumes and ensure seamless scalability.
Experience in designing enterprise APIs.
Experience in RESTful web services.
Experience in Microservices architecture.
Experience in Object Oriented Programming (OOP) paradigms.
Experience with the agile software lifecycle.
Has a proven ability to learn quickly and works well both independently as well as in a team setting.
Experience with the Linux operating system.
Experience with configuration management tools (e.g. Git, Nexus, Maven).
Must be willing to travel to San Antonio, TX for an average of 3-4 days at a time every 3 months.
Must be able to work in a hybrid environment, spending an average of 1-2 days per week on customer site in Ft. Meade or Columbia, MD. Flexibility is essential to adapt to schedule changes as needed.
Benefits
100% paid employee premium for healthcare, vision and dental plans.
Senior Software Engineer at Nuix developing solutions for eDiscovery and data governance. Collaborating in Agile teams to deliver software projects with a focus on performance and reliability.
Backend infrastructure developer working on software that powers kiosks for global checkout experience. Join a high - impact team at Mashgin to create innovative AI solutions.
Full Stack Developer Intern assisting in web application development for Seagate's AI transformation projects. Collaborating with Data Scientists and developers on front and back - end technologies.
Senior Engineer providing engineering support and oversight for structural steel modules fabrication for AP1000 European and US Domestic plants. Collaborating with supply chain and managing fabrication processes.
Software Engineering Intern contributing to Universal Robots' robotics software development team in Bengaluru. Collaborating on modern UI and scalable architecture with hands - on experience.
Staff Software Engineer managing and architecting subscription product solutions at Coinbase. Leading technical direction and mentoring team members in high - impact projects.
Senior Software Engineer embedding machine learning models into operational workflows at Upstart. Driving personalization strategies and improving servicing decisions with data - driven approaches.
Software Engineer building next generation crypto - forward products for Coinbase. Solving complex technical challenges in cryptocurrency and blockchain technology.
Software Architect at PointClickCare developing effective software solutions for the healthcare industry. Collaborating with teams to drive technical innovation and feasibility in software design.
Senior Software Engineer at CoreWeave designing secure sandboxed environments for GPU - accelerated workloads on Kubernetes. Collaborating across teams to optimize performance and ensure security in multi - tenant architectures.